🪔 About
Pandit Raghunath Panigrahi (August 10, 1932 – August 25, 2013) was a celebrated Indian classical vocalist, composer, and music director, primarily known for his profound contributions to Odissi music. Born in Gunupur, Rayagada, Odisha, he hailed from a family with a long lineage in Odissi music. He received his initial musical training from his father, Pt. Nilamani Panigrahi, who preserved traditional Odissi melodies of the Gita Govinda from the Jagannatha Temple in Puri. He further honed his skills under the tutelage of Odissi music exponents Pt. Narasingha Nandasarma and Pt. Biswanatha Das. Panigrahi initially pursued a successful career as a playback singer in Odia, Telugu, Tamil, and Kannada films, becoming a regular artist for All India Radio since 1948. However, he chose to leave his flourishing film career in Chennai to dedicate himself to providing vocal accompaniment for his wife, the legendary Odissi danseuse Sanjukta Panigrahi. Together, the duo became instrumental in popularizing Odissi dance and music globally from the 1960s to the 1990s. Widely known as 'Gitagobinda Panigrahi' for his exquisite renditions of Jayadeva's Gita Govinda, he made a lifetime contribution to promoting and propagating the poet's works and the cult of Lord Jagannatha. After Sanjukta Panigrahi's demise in 1997, he continued his artistic journey, associating with Nrityagram and composing music for many of their productions. In 1999, he founded the Sanjukta Panigrahi Memorial Trust to further the cause of Odissi dance, which, since 2001, has been awarding scholarships and awards of excellence to budding dancers. The trust was later renamed the 'Sanjukta and Raghunath Panigrahi Cultural Heritage Foundation' in 2012 by his elder son, Parthasarathi Panigrahi. Pandit Raghunath Panigrahi passed away on August 25, 2013, in Bhubaneswar. Awards & Honours: Sur Mani (1968), Award from the Government of France (1976), Sangeet Natak Akademi Award (1976), State Sangeet Natak Akademi Award (1993), Jayadeva Samman (2008), Lifetime Achievement award of Banichitra Awards (2008), Padma Shri (2010), Doctor of Literature (Honoris Causa) (2010), Doctor of Literature (Honoris Causa) (2011), Doctor of Literature (Honoris Causa) (2013), Sangeet Natak Akademi Fellowship.
